Digital Locations Announces Disruptive Satellite-to-Smartphone Technology

Digital Locations Announces Disruptive Satellite-to-Smartphone Technology

The Company is working with Florida International University to develop a disruptive technology that will deliver high-speed Internet from satellites directly to smartphones all over the world

SANTA BARBARA, Calif., June 08,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Digital Locations, Inc. (), the developer of a disruptive technology that will deliver high-speed Internet from satellites directly to smartphones all over the world, today announced that it has entered into to an agreement with Florida International University to lead the development program.

“We believe that our satellite-to-smartphone technology can have worldwide impact and be the most disruptive satellite communications technology since the introduction of GPS,” said Rich Berliner, CEO of Digital Locations.

In a digitally divided world of haves and have nots, high-speed Internet (also known as broadband Internet) is the great equalizer. However, high-speed Internet is only available in densely populated areas around the world. The rest of the world is still waiting.

Elon Musk (SpaceX), Jeff Bezos (Blue Origin) and others are launching thousands of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ellites. Unfortunately, without the use of additional equipment, the technology does yet exist that will allow these satellites to deliver high-speed Internet to smartphones. Connecting these satellites with the smartphones of the future to receive high-speed Internet service is technically very challenging but represents an extraordinary business opportunity.

According to Grand View Research, the global broadband market was valued at $419 billion in 2022 and is expected to grow to $875 billion by 2030. This tremendous growth is driven by the continual digital transformation of virtually all industries such as retail, healthcare, government, entertainment, and many more. Wireless technology holds great potential, due to its relative ease of deployment, in accelerating the global digital revolution across many verticals through productivity enhancements and economic reductions.

Mr. Berliner continued, “We are thrilled to be working with Florida International University. Their research team includes world renown experts in the field of wireless communications and antenna systems. Our goal is to develop a truly disruptive technology that will finally make it possible for the wireless industry to offer high-speed Internet service from satellites directly to smartphones, indoors and outdoors with no dead zones and no cell towers.”

Under the terms of the research agreement with Florida International University, the Company has a non-exclusive, royalty-free license to use the intellectual property associated with the development project, as well as the right to negotiate an exclusive license.
